About James C. Sproat
James Christopher Sproat, known as Jim, is a dedicated attorney with Smith, Born, Leventis, Taylor & Vega, LLC. He earned his Bachelor of Arts in Political Science from the University of South Carolina in 2008, followed by a Juris Doctor from the University of Cincinnati College of Law in 2011. During his time at Cincinnati, Jim held leadership roles as the Student Bar Association President and Managing Editor of the Immigration and Nationality Law Review.
Jim was admitted to the South Carolina Bar in 2011. His early career included valuable experience with the US District Court for the Southern District of Ohio and the South Carolina Court of Appeals. Initially, Jim focused on Construction Law and Business Litigation, but he has since shifted his practice to Personal Injury and Workers’ Compensation, where he continues to serve clients effectively.

South Carolina Car Accident Laws
Understanding South Carolina's accident laws is critical when pursuing a claim. Here are the key legal rules that apply to your case:
Statute of Limitations
3 years
Time limit to file a claim
Negligence Rule
modified comparative fault (51%)
How fault is determined
Min. Insurance (BI/PD)
$25K/$50K/$25K
Per person/per accident/property
Insurance System
At-Fault
At-fault driver's insurance pays
